Up to £1m is set to be spent on improving shopping areas in Sunderland.
City council bosses are considering spending the cash on a variety of projects, including a revamp of Christmas street lights.
The move follows recent improvements to Athenaeum Street, Union Street and in the High Street West area, which saw new paving and extra litter squads.
A city council spokesman said improving areas used by shoppers was an ongoing priority.
Bryan Charlton, who oversees regeneration as part of his cabinet portfolio, added: "People will have already seen improvements with the street scene and we are looking at more ways of improving the city centre."
Councillors are due to discuss the improvement programme on 3 June.
